Implementing Advanced Data Collection Techniques for Precise Personalization in Content Marketing

In the realm of data-driven content marketing, the foundation of effective personalization lies in the quality and granularity of data collected. Moving beyond basic page views and click counts, this deep dive explores the technical intricacies of implementing sophisticated data collection methodologies that enable hyper-personalized user experiences. We will dissect the specific steps, tools, and best practices necessary to capture, process, and utilize granular user data effectively, while avoiding common pitfalls related to privacy, bias, and data integrity.

Contents

a) Utilizing Event-Based Tracking and User Interactions to Capture Granular Data

Event-based tracking is the cornerstone of granular data collection, capturing specific user actions that reveal intent, engagement levels, and preferences. To implement this effectively, follow these actionable steps:

  1. Define Key User Events: Collaborate with product and marketing teams to identify critical interactions such as button clicks, form submissions, scroll depth, video plays, and hover events. For instance, in an e-commerce site, track ‘Add to Cart’, ‘Wishlist’, and ‘Product View’ events.
  2. Utilize Tag Management Systems (TMS): Implement a robust TMS like Google Tag Manager (GTM) to deploy custom event tags without modifying site code directly. Use GTM triggers to fire tags based on user interactions accurately.
  3. Implement Data Layer Variables: Structure a data layer that captures contextual information with each event, such as product ID, category, user status, or device type. This structured data ensures consistency and ease of analysis.
  4. Set Up Custom Event Listeners: For complex interactions (e.g., multi-step forms), develop custom JavaScript listeners that push detailed event data into the data layer. For example:
  5. <script>
    document.querySelector('#submitBtn').addEventListener('click', function() {
      dataLayer.push({
        'event': 'formSubmission',
        'formID': 'newsletterSignup',
        'userType': 'newVisitor'
      });
    });
    </script>
    
  6. Leverage SDKs for Mobile and App Tracking: Use platform-specific SDKs (e.g., Firebase, Adjust) to capture user interactions within mobile apps, ensuring consistency across channels.

Expert Tip: Regularly audit your event taxonomy to eliminate redundant or ambiguous events, and prioritize high-value interactions to optimize data quality and storage costs.

b) Integrating Third-Party Data Sources for Enriched User Profiles

Augmenting first-party tracking with third-party data significantly enhances user profiles, enabling more precise segmentation and personalization. To do this systematically:

  1. Select Reputable Data Providers: Partner with data aggregators like Acxiom, Oracle Data Cloud, or Nielsen, focusing on sources aligned with your target demographics and privacy standards.
  2. Establish Data Integration Pipelines: Use ETL tools such as Apache NiFi, Talend, or custom APIs to securely ingest third-party datasets into your data warehouse or customer data platform (CDP). Ensure data formats are consistent (e.g., JSON, CSV) and schemas are well-defined.
  3. Match and Enrich User Profiles: Use deterministic matching techniques, like email or phone number hashes, and probabilistic methods based on behavioral patterns, to link third-party data with existing user records. For example, merge demographic attributes like income level, occupation, or lifestyle segments.
  4. Maintain Data Freshness and Compliance: Schedule regular updates and ensure compliance with privacy regulations by obtaining explicit consent and respecting data opt-outs.
  5. Example – Enrichment Workflow: A user browses products on your site and consents to third-party data sharing. Your system fetches additional info like social media interests or offline purchase history and updates their profile in your CDP, enabling tailored content.

Expert Tip: Always verify data quality through sampling and validation before deploying enriched profiles in personalization algorithms. Avoid over-reliance on third-party data that may introduce bias or inaccuracies.

c) Setting Up Real-Time Data Capture Infrastructure: Tools and Best Practices

Building a reliable, scalable infrastructure for real-time data capture requires selecting appropriate tools and establishing robust workflows. Follow these steps for an effective setup:

  1. Choose a Data Streaming Platform: Implement Apache Kafka, AWS Kinesis, or Google Cloud Pub/Sub to handle high-throughput, low-latency data ingestion.
  2. Implement Data Collection Agents: Deploy lightweight SDKs or JavaScript snippets that push data asynchronously to streaming platforms. For example, configure GTM or custom scripts to send event data directly to Kafka topics.
  3. Design Data Schemas and Serialization: Use consistent schemas with Avro, Protocol Buffers, or JSON Schema to ensure data integrity across systems. Version schemas to manage updates smoothly.
  4. Set Up Data Storage and Processing Pipelines: Use cloud data warehouses like Snowflake, BigQuery, or Redshift for storage; employ Spark or Flink for real-time processing, enabling immediate segmentation or personalization triggers.
  5. Implement Data Quality and Monitoring: Use tools like Datadog, Prometheus, or custom dashboards to track ingestion latency, error rates, and data completeness. Establish alerting for anomalies.

Expert Tip: Optimize data pipelines by batching non-critical data and prioritizing latency-sensitive events. Regularly test end-to-end latency to ensure real-time requirements are met.

d) Avoiding Common Pitfalls in Data Collection: Privacy, Bias, and Data Quality

Robust data collection is not just about technology; it requires vigilant adherence to ethical standards and data quality practices. Here are specific strategies:

  1. Privacy Compliance: Incorporate consent management platforms like OneTrust or TrustArc to handle user opt-in/opt-out preferences. Use transparent privacy notices and allow users to control data sharing.
  2. Data Anonymization and Pseudonymization: Apply techniques such as k-anonymity, differential privacy, or hashing personally identifiable information (PII) before storage or analysis, reducing risk of re-identification.
  3. Mitigate Bias: Regularly audit your datasets for demographic or behavioral biases. Use fairness-aware algorithms and diversify data sources to improve representation.
  4. Ensure Data Quality: Establish validation scripts that check for missing fields, inconsistent formats, or outliers immediately after data ingestion. Use data profiling tools for ongoing quality assessment.
  5. Documentation and Governance: Maintain detailed data dictionaries, lineage, and access logs. Enforce strict access controls and review processes to prevent unauthorized data manipulation.

Expert Tip: Continuously update your privacy and bias mitigation strategies in response to evolving regulations like GDPR and CCPA, and emerging best practices in ethical data handling.

Conclusion

Implementing advanced data collection techniques is a critical step towards achieving true personalization in content marketing. By meticulously defining and deploying event-based tracking, integrating enriched third-party data, establishing scalable real-time infrastructures, and vigilantly avoiding ethical pitfalls, marketers can craft highly relevant, engaging experiences that resonate with individual users. These practices not only enhance immediate campaign performance but also foster long-term trust and loyalty.

For a comprehensive understanding of how these data collection strategies fit into the broader personalization framework, explore our foundational article on {tier1_anchor}. Additionally, delve into our detailed Tier 2 guide on {tier2_anchor} to see how these techniques integrate into overall content marketing efforts.

Leave a Reply

Your email address will not be published. Required fields are marked *